It is a portable test instrument used to amplify and analyze the tiny signal measured by the strain gauge. Strain gauge amplifiers can amplify various signals such as high frequency, low frequency, and DC through gain adjustment and filtering, and convert them into signals suitable for display and analysis. It is used to test performance data such as strength, load capacity, vibration, etc. of structures, machinery, and electrical equipment. Due to its small size, portability, and easy operation, portable strain gauge amplifiers are easier to use in the field than traditional strain testing instruments.
